+x Rob Robinson - 11/25/2021 7:35:56 AMHi Toby,Just to clarify what your objective is, rather than imagining one possible solution for that objective, some questions:1. Do you need to know the entire length of a Cable object? Or just part of the Cable? What about the length of other objects?2. What do you want to do with that information? Display it on the drawing? In the Cable Schedule? Anywhere else?3. in what drawing types is this a requirement? (Block Schematic? Rack Layout? Panel Layout? etc)In other words, what is the problem you're trying to solve?
+x Rob Robinson - 11/26/2021 11:56:33 AMHi Toby,OK, part of the problem that you want to solve is to get the measurement of the distance between 2 points as described by an arbitrary path. Can we assume that the path can be described by a single polyline i.e. made of straight line segments? Or are there times when one or more of those segments might be a curve?Now that we know that you want the non-direct distance between 2 points the next question is what do you want to do with that data? Should the value appear on the drawing or could it be implemented as a field in the Properties Grid, or...?Once you have the value, how will you use it? Is it just a case of manually transcribing the value into some other platform where you do the estimation, or...?Is any data other than just the distance required?Hopefully you can see how this process of trying to understand the problem you're trying to solve works, fully examining the requirements as opposed to settling on a possible solution. When we understand exactly what you want to achieve, then we can figure out the best way to do that in an elegant and flexible fashion